Nacos 1.3.0版本部署连接mysql 8+

 

此处需要在1.3版本增加 mysql 8+ 的配置:

1、nacos-server-1.3.0下面依次创建包: plugins/mysql/ ,网上有很多博主写着 在nacos_home目录下新增 nacos/plugins/mysql/ ,其实,这里的nacos就是上一层的nacos,也就是我这里重新命名的 nacos-server-1.3.0

2、将从网上任意下载的 mysql 8+ 的jar包丢进来创建的目录,此处传送:

wget https://repo1.maven.org/maven2/mysql/mysql-connector-java/8.0.20/mysql-connector-java-8.0.20.jar

3、配置文件(application.properties)中打开数据库配置,并在url末尾增加 &serverTimezone=UTC(1.3.0已经默认增加进来了,所以此处可以忽略)

4、进入bin目录下

执行单机模式:
./startup.sh -m standalone

查看日志信息:
cat /NACOS_HOME/logs/start.out

访问页面地址,就可以看到前面的登录页面了,登录账号默认:nacos,密码默认:nacos:
http://127.0.0.1:8848/nacos/index.html

 5、启动

启动nacos 服务技巧:

linux环境下:
Linux:sh startup.sh -m standalone 单机启动模式
这种启动方式有弊端,在关闭命令窗口后nacos进程会直接shutdown,导致服务停止。
解决方法:
在nacos 0.6.0版本(包括0.6.0)
用命令 sh startup.sh -m standalone & 启动nacos服务,
nacos版本高于0.6.0,上面命令还是会出现问题,
建议采用下面的命令
nohup sh startup.sh -m standalone &
或者使用
setsid sh startup.sh -m standalone &

windows环境下:
Windows:cmd startup.cmd -m standalone 单机启动模式

原文地址:https://www.cnblogs.com/yuchuan/p/nacos_install.html